Title: Kathrin Junge: Innovator in Catalysis
Introduction
Kathrin Junge is a prominent inventor based in Rostock, Germany. She has made significant contributions to the field of catalysis, particularly in the development of new iridium catalysts for enantioselective hydrogenation processes. With a total of 4 patents to her name, Junge's work has garnered attention in both academic and industrial circles.
Latest Patents
Among her latest patents, Junge has developed a process that utilizes new iridium catalysts for the enantioselective hydrogenation of 4-substituted 1,2-dihydroquinolines. This innovative process allows for the preparation of optically active 4-substituted 1,2,3,4-tetrahydroquinolines using a chiral iridium (P,N)-ligand catalyst. Additionally, she has patented a process for producing methanol through the catalyzed reaction of carbon monoxide and hydrogen, which involves a catalyst comprising a transition metal and at least one Lewis basic ligand.
